The island of Krakatoa was almost completely destroyed by a volcanic eruption in 1883. This catastrophic event not only devastated the island itself, but also had far-reaching effects on the surrounding areas and even impacted global climate patterns. The eruption of Krakatoa in 1883 was one of the most powerful volcanic events in recorded history. The explosion was so massive that it could be heard over 3,000 miles away, and the resulting tsunami waves reached heights of up to 130 feet. The eruption ejected an estimated 6 cubic miles of material into the atmosphere, causing a dramatic decrease in global temperatures and producing vivid sunsets around the world for several years. The aftermath of the Krakatoa eruption was truly devastating. The once lush and vibrant island was reduced to a barren wasteland, with only a fraction of its original landmass remaining. The surrounding seas were littered with debris and the air was filled with ash and toxic gases. The local population was almost entirely wiped out, with only a few lucky survivors managing to escape the destruction. Despite the immense tragedy of the Krakatoa eruption, the island has slowly begun to recover in the years since. Vegetation has started to regrow, and wildlife has returned to the area. However, the scars of the eruption are still visible, serving as a stark reminder of the power of nature.
